Hire Qualified Staff

This tip may seem like an obvious one, but it bears repeating. Your staff is the backbone of your business, so be sure to take the time to find employees who are qualified and have the experience necessary to do their job well.

Some tips to make sure you hire the right staff include:

  • Conduct thorough interviews
  • Check references
  • Make sure they have the necessary qualifications (including certification if required in your state)

Keep Accurate and Up-to-Date Records

Keeping accurate records is important for two reasons. First, accurate records will help you track your laboratory’s progress and identify areas where your team can improve. Whether it’s keeping track of inventory levels or patient data, accurate records are essential to running a successful laboratory.

Second, many accreditation organizations require up-to-date records. If your laboratory isn’t accredited, you may consider doing so. This difference can give your business a competitive edge and show potential customers that you take quality control seriously. Learning the best labeling practices for your laboratory can help you stay compliant with accreditation standards.

Some tips for keeping accurate records include:

  • Use a computerized system to track data
  • Be sure to back up your data regularly
  • Train staff on how to enter information correctly

Invest in Quality Equipment

To produce accurate results, your laboratory must have high-quality equipment. The right equipment will make your staff’s jobs easier and improve efficiency. The last thing you want is for your laboratory to produce inaccurate results! It could cost you customers and damage your reputation.

Try To Reduce Turnaround Times

Nobody likes to wait, especially when getting results back from a laboratory. The sooner you can turn around results, the better. Training your staff on how to work efficiently can help reduce turnaround times. You may also consider investing in additional staff or new equipment if turnarounds are too long.
